Source code
InfoField

Asymptote code

import settings;
outformat="pdf";

size(10cm,4cm);

real t = 0.33;

pair[][] P = {{(0,0), (0.25,1.5), (1,2), (1,0)},
 {(0,0), (0.5,1), (1,2), (1,0)},
 {(0,0), (0.5,1), (1,2), (1,0)},
 {(0,0), (0.5,1), (1,2), (1,0)}};
path C[] = {nullpath, nullpath, nullpath, nullpath};
path g,ctr,d;
g = P[0][0]..controls P[0][1] and P[0][2]..P[0][3];
d = scale(0.025)*unitcircle;

int i,j,k;
C[0] = P[0][0]--P[0][1]--P[0][2]--P[0][3];

for(i = 1; i <= 3; ++i) {
  for(j = 0; j <= 3-i; ++j) {
    P[i][j] = (1-t)*P[i-1][j] + t*P[i-1][j+1];
    C[i] = C[i]--P[i][j];
  }
}

for(k =  0; k < 3; ++k) {
  draw(shift((2*k,0)) * C[k]);

  for(i = 0; i < 4-k; ++i) {
    string L = format("$P_%d$",i);
    label(L, shift((2*k,0)) * P[k][i], i < (4-k)/2 ? W : E);
    filldraw(shift((2*k,0)) * shift(P[k][i])*d);
  }

  draw(shift((2*k,0)) * C[k+1], dashed);

  for(i = 0; i < 3-k; ++i)
    draw(shift((2*k,0)) * shift(P[k+1][i])*d);

  draw(shift((2*k,0)) * g);
}
